Output 90be85712c1331c8eeae0cf5d7452e4e1d30acbe80057fef2e56b62530795cd7:2

value
45108327
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e5b8f636374ed7abeed3c68191966e8bf58efac3 OP_EQUAL
address
MUqpYjBUrouTcMyGywgq9x86HfBa4YXJUC
transaction
90be85712c1331c8eeae0cf5d7452e4e1d30acbe80057fef2e56b62530795cd7
spent
true